An excellent CD by an excellent bandSister Hazel is a band whose music is a unique mix of rock, pop, country, and bluegrass that is simply irresistable. The stands out due to its four-yes four- guitarists and the unique metallic voice of lead singer Ken Block.Chasing Daylight continues the band's streak of excellent albums. Beginning with the wonderful "Your Mistake" and ending with the equally great "Can't Believe," this is a CD without a weak point. This is not in the same league as FortressI honestly don't see how this album could get better reviews than "Fortress". Of the few songs on here that are strong not a one stands up to what Sister Hazel did on Fortress or Somewhere more Familiar. Please don't get me wrong I am a huge Hazel Nut, but I must say that this album borders on tedious.
